Output d23f53866a3088b98a5112150736c5a81045b16550a7d07546cf5f6d0fc38273:18

value
12824249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fbca028988f21826b88afc2d163b6201a03d450 OP_EQUAL
address
MFAmaXGFmRskBoNTQHRnMM9cPuX7GxgXQv
transaction
d23f53866a3088b98a5112150736c5a81045b16550a7d07546cf5f6d0fc38273
spent
true